Layer 1、Layer 2、Layer 3、平行链与侧链:核心差异解析

·

区块链技术的快速发展催生了多种扩容方案,从基础架构到创新应用,Layer 1、Layer 2、Layer 3、平行链和侧链共同构成了多元化的生态系统。理解这些核心概念的区别与联系,对于开发者、投资者和用户至关重要。本文将深入解析这些技术的定义、特点与实际应用,助您全面把握区块链分层架构的演进逻辑。

Layer 1:基础底层区块链

Layer 1 区块链是网络的基础架构,负责执行交易、数据可用性和共识机制,无需依赖其他网络即可验证并完成交易。典型的 Layer 1 包括比特币、以太坊、BNB Chain 和 Solana 等。每条 Layer 1 区块链均拥有原生代币,用于支付交易费用。

然而,Layer 1 的扩容面临重大挑战,通常需要通过修改核心协议来实现,例如增加区块大小、采用新共识机制或实施分片技术。这些改动往往需要社区共识和硬分叉,过程复杂且耗时。

Layer 2:扩容解决方案

为解决 Layer 1 的扩容限制,Layer 2 方案应运而生。它们作为二级框架构建在现有网络之上,将部分交易需求从主链转移至相邻系统架构,在链下处理交易后仅将最终状态记录在 Layer 1 上。

常见的 Layer 2 扩容技术包括:

这些协议大多继承底层 Layer 1 的安全性,同时显著提升处理速度、降低交易成本。以太坊基金会已明确转向 Layer 2 扩容方案,取代早期的 Plasma 方案,并逐步采用 Rollup 和 Danksharding 技术。

Layer 3:应用专用链

Layer 3 区块链是建立在 Layer 2 网络上的应用专用链,可实现进一步扩容、定制化和互操作性。例如 Arbitrum Orbit 允许开发创建在 Arbitrum Layer 2 上结算的“Orbit 链”,这些链可定制燃料代币、吞吐量、隐私和治理机制。

类似地,Optimism 的 OP Stack 支持“超级链”Layer 3 网络,共享安全性和通信层,Coinbase 的 Base 就是其典型代表。其他 Layer 3 解决方案还包括 zkSync 的 Hyperchains 和 Polygon 的 Supernets。

Layer 3 的核心优势包括:

平行链:波卡生态的创新设计

平行链是 Polkadot 和 Kusama 网络的核心组件,作为应用专用的独立区块链,在这些生态系统中并行运行。它们连接到主中继链(Relay Chain),租赁其安全性同时保持自身治理、代币和功能。

平行链通过 XCMP 等跨链通信协议实现无缝数据传输和交易处理。收集者节点(Collator)维护平行链的完整状态并向中继链验证者提供证明。这种设计使得平行链在保持独立性的同时,享受共享安全性的好处。

侧链:并行运行的独立链

侧链是与主链并行运行的独立区块链,通过双向锚定机制实现代币和数字资产在链间转移。侧链拥有自己的共识机制和区块参数,相比主链更具灵活性和扩展性。

侧链被视为 Layer 2 解决方案的一种,因为它们分担了主链的部分交易负担。典型案例包括比特币的 Liquid 侧链和以太坊的 Polygon PoS。关键区别在于,像 Polygon PoS 这样的链拥有自己的安全性和验证器集,而不依赖 Layer 1 提供网络安全。

技术对比与适用场景

技术类型安全性来源核心特点典型应用
Layer 1自身共识机制基础架构、独立运行比特币、以太坊
Layer 2继承 Layer 1提升效率、降低成本Rollup、状态通道
Layer 3依赖 Layer 2应用专用、高度定制Arbitrum Orbit
平行链租赁中继链跨链互操作、独立治理Polkadot 生态项目
侧链自身验证者集独立共识、资产跨链Polygon PoS

👉 探索更多区块链扩容策略

常见问题

Layer 1 和 Layer 2 的主要区别是什么?

Layer 1 是基础区块链网络,独立处理所有交易和共识;Layer 2 是构建在 Layer 1 之上的扩容方案,通过链下处理交易提升性能,同时依赖 Layer 1 提供最终安全性。

Layer 3 相比 Layer 2 有哪些优势?

Layer 3 在 Layer 2 的基础上进一步提供应用专用化的定制能力,包括自定义燃料代币、隐私特性和治理机制,同时通过递归证明实现更高效的扩容效果。

平行链与侧链的安全性机制有何不同?

平行链通过租赁中继链的安全性来获得保护,而侧链通常维护自己独立的验证者集合和共识机制,自成一体地提供网络安全保障。

这些扩容技术是否可以共存?

完全可以。不同的扩容技术针对特定需求设计,在实际应用中往往相互配合。例如一个项目可能同时采用 Layer 2 进行交易处理,并通过侧链实现特定功能模块。

普通用户如何选择适合的链?

用户应根据具体需求选择:重视安全性可优先选择 Layer 1;追求交易速度和低费用可考虑 Layer 2;需要特定应用功能可关注 Layer 3 或平行链;跨链操作需求多则可使用侧链方案。

结语

区块链分层架构的演进体现了技术创新与实际需求的深度结合。Layer 1 作为坚实基础,Layer 2 提供扩容方案,Layer 3 实现应用定制,平行链和侧链则拓展了跨链互操作的可能性。每种技术都有其独特的优势和适用场景,共同推动区块链生态系统向更高效、更互联的方向发展。随着技术的不断成熟,这些解决方案将继续演化,为去中心化应用带来更强大的支撑能力。